Transaction bc84e6d58843658beeac6324a867afaa7e7c9d6a4c626d860d34c33c4d44efcf
1 Input
1 Output
-
bc84e6d58843658beeac6324a867afaa7e7c9d6a4c626d860d34c33c4d44efcf:0
- value
- 25399
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4ff88c1e3545f3cac33a4745ae38499d64048b0f672a54d1c7f809b3a380f0ad
- address
- bc1pflugc834gheu4se6gaz6uwzfn4jqfzc0vu49f5w8lqym8guq7zkswr2q6l